Re[2]: Как заставить работать CALLBACK?
От: skwirpl  
Дата: 24.03.02 20:35
Оценка:
Здравствуйте VladD2, Вы писали:

VD>Здравствуйте skwirpl, Вы писали:


VD>Я так понимаю, что или в потоке COM не инициализирован, или интерфейс не смаршален для этого потока. Какую ошибку то выдают?


Да, похоже что когда CALLBACK вызывается системой то он работает в отдельном потоке. Ошибка — "access violation" в модуле msvbvm60.dll. Получается, что надо в CALLBACK функции инициализировать COM и получать смаршаленный указаель через GIT или чего-нибудь еще, или есть менее накладный путь?
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.